Market Size and Trends
The Mobile Leak Detection Platforms market is estimated to be valued at USD 1.45 billion in 2025 and is expected to reach USD 3.75 billion by 2032, growing at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 14.2% from 2025 to 2032. This significant growth is driven by increasing demand for efficient leak detection solutions across various industries, such as oil & gas, water management, and manufacturing, where minimizing losses and environmental impact is critical.
The market trend is characterized by the adoption of advanced technologies like IoT-enabled sensors, AI-powered analytics, and mobile platforms that offer real-time monitoring and predictive maintenance capabilities. Additionally, the integration of mobile leak detection solutions with cloud computing and data visualization tools enhances operational efficiency, enabling faster decision-making. Growing regulatory pressure on environmental safety and rising awareness about resource conservation further propel market growth.

By Technology: Ultrasonic Detection Dominance Driven by Precision and Versatility
In terms of By Technology, Ultrasonic Detection contributes the highest share of the market owing to its superior accuracy, ease of deployment, and cost-effectiveness in identifying leaks across various environments. Ultrasonic leak detection operates by capturing sound waves that escape from pressurized systems, which are often inaudible to the human ear but indicate the presence of gas or fluid leaks. This technology stands out because it provides real-time results without requiring direct contact with the source of the leak, making it exceptionally versatile for both indoor and outdoor applications. Furthermore, the non-invasive nature of ultrasonic devices reduces downtime during inspections, an essential factor for industries where operational continuity is critical.
Thermal imaging, pressure decay, and helium leak detection, while valuable, serve more niche or complementary purposes compared to ultrasonic methods. Thermal imaging is effective for detecting temperature variations caused by leaks but can be limited by environmental conditions like ambient temperature and requires skilled operators. Pressure decay methods demand system pressurization and are typically used for quality control rather than ongoing leak detection. Helium leak detection offers extremely high sensitivity but is generally more expensive and suited to highly specialized use cases such as aerospace or semiconductor manufacturing.
Key drivers supporting ultrasonic detection's growth include increasing regulatory pressures to minimize environmental pollution and workplace hazards, alongside advancements in sensor miniaturization and digital signal processing, which enhance detection precision and device portability. Additionally, industries are prioritizing preventive maintenance and energy efficiency, both of which benefit from the early detection capabilities that ultrasonic technology provides. As a result, investments in research and development are continuously improving ultrasonic sensors' performance and integration with mobile platforms, reinforcing its dominant market position.
By Application: Consumer Electronics Leading Adoption Due to Leak Sensitivity and Product Complexity
In terms of By Application, Consumer Electronics contributes the highest share of the market attributed to the heightened sensitivity required for detecting minute leaks and quality defects in compact, complex devices. Leak detection in consumer electronics is critical not only for maintaining product performance but also for ensuring user safety, especially in battery-operated devices where fluid ingress or gas leaks could lead to malfunctions or hazardous situations. Mobile leak detection platforms are widely employed to scrutinize devices such as smartphones, tablets, and wearable technology, which have intricate internal architectures and limited tolerance for manufacturing defects.
The rapid growth and innovation pace of consumer electronics drive demand for leak detection solutions that can keep up with volume production lines while maintaining high accuracy. The ability of mobile platforms to provide flexible, on-the-go testing aligns well with manufacturing environments, where space constraints and fast turnaround times prevail. Moreover, consumer expectations for product reliability and extended warranty periods pressure manufacturers to incorporate stringent leak testing protocols during assembly and final inspection.
Other sectors like automotive and aerospace adopt leak detection primarily for safety and performance compliance; however, the sheer volume and variety of consumer electronics products amplify the market influence of this segment. The trend toward miniaturization and the integration of unconventional materials further increase the complexity of leak detection, making mobile detection platforms an indispensable tool for manufacturers focused on product differentiation and defect minimization.
By End-User: OEMs Driving Market Growth Through Integration and Quality Control Priorities
In terms of By End-User, Original Equipment Manufacturers (OEMs) contribute the highest share of the market, driven by their critical role in embedding leak detection technologies into manufacturing processes and product design validation phases. OEMs are focused on building reliability, durability, and safety directly into their products, requiring sophisticated leak detection platforms that can be seamlessly integrated across various stages of production. This proactive approach reduces the likelihood of product recalls, warranty costs, and brand reputation damage due to undetected leaks or component failures.
The advancement of mobile leak detection platforms empowers OEMs with flexible, scalable solutions that enhance quality control systems without compromising factory throughput. These platforms enable the implementation of consistent inspection protocols, traceability, and faster defect identification, contributing to more efficient production cycles. Additionally, OEMs often collaborate with technology providers to customize leak detection tools tailored to the unique features of their products, ranging from automotive fuel systems to industrial machinery.
Apart from reinforcing in-house quality frameworks, OEMs also respond to stringent regulatory standards and environmental compliance requirements that necessitate comprehensive leak testing. By adopting mobile leak detection solutions, OEMs benefit from reduced operational costs, improved product lifespan, and the ability to meet evolving market expectations for safety and sustainability. This strategic adoption within OEM operations secures their position at the forefront of mobile leak detection platform growth, supporting continual innovation and global competitiveness.
Regional Insights:
Dominating Region: North America
In North America, the dominance in the Mobile Leak Detection Platforms market is primarily driven by the region's advanced technological infrastructure, strong presence of key industry players, and supportive regulatory environment. The well-established ecosystem of technology providers, industrial vendors, and service companies fosters innovation and adoption of sophisticated leak detection solutions tailored for various sectors including oil & gas, municipal water systems, and manufacturing. Government policies promoting infrastructure modernization and environmental compliance contribute significantly to market growth. Notable companies such as Honeywell International Inc., FLIR Systems (a Teledyne Technologies company), and Aclara Technologies have developed cutting-edge mobile leak detection platforms that integrate with IoT and AI technologies, reinforcing the region's leadership position through continuous product enhancement and strategic partnerships.
Fastest-Growing Region: Asia Pacific
Meanwhile, the Asia Pacific exhibits the fastest growth in the Mobile Leak Detection Platforms market due to rapid urbanization, industrial expansion, and increasing investments in smart city projects across countries like China, India, and Japan. The market here benefits from growing government initiatives focusing on infrastructure development, environmental sustainability, and water conservation. Trade dynamics favor regional technology transfer and collaborations between domestic firms and international players, enhancing accessibility to advanced leak detection solutions. Companies like Huawei, Panasonic, and Keyence are actively contributing by introducing localized mobile leak detection solutions that address specific industry needs. Additionally, growing awareness about reducing operational losses and environmental impact acts as a catalyst for accelerated adoption in this region.
Mobile Leak Detection Platforms Market Outlook for Key Countries
United States
The United States' market for mobile leak detection platforms is robust, driven by stringent regulatory frameworks and significant investments in infrastructure renewal and environmental monitoring. Domestic leaders like Honeywell and FLIR Systems leverage advanced sensor and imaging technologies to serve diverse industries, including oil & gas pipelines, utility networks, and chemical plants. Their continuous innovation in AI-powered and wireless mobile platforms enhances efficiency and accuracy, establishing the U.S. as a benchmark in leak detection solutions.
China
China's market rapidly advances due to expansive industrial growth and ambitious government initiatives targeting water resource management and pollution control. Companies such as Huawei and local startups emphasize integration of IoT and big data analytics into mobile leak detection solutions, optimizing system responsiveness and predictive maintenance capabilities. Moreover, the Chinese government's focus on reducing industrial emissions and improving urban infrastructure significantly boosts demand for mobile leak detection platforms.
Germany
Germany continues to lead in Europe's mobile leak detection market by capitalizing on its strong manufacturing sector and commitment to environmental standards. Renowned companies like Endress+Hauser and WIKA AG are instrumental in developing precision leak detection technologies that cater to the automotive, chemical, and energy sectors. Germany's stringent regulatory policies on safety and emission controls drive continuous advancements and adoption of portable leak detection devices.
India
India's market is characterized by increasing urban infrastructure projects and growing demand for water loss management solutions. Key players, including Honeywell and Panasonic, are expanding their footprint by offering cost-effective and durable mobile detection platforms tailored to the local environment. Government programs aimed at sustainable development and smart city implementations serve as key enablers for market proliferation in both industrial and municipal segments.
Japan
Japan's mobile leak detection market benefits from technological innovation and a high standard of industrial safety regulations. Companies such as Keyence and Panasonic utilize advanced sensor fusion and robotics to deliver mobile platforms adapted for high-precision leak detection in sectors like semiconductor manufacturing and utilities. Japan's collaborative ecosystem between research institutions and industry supports continuous evolution of mobile leak detection technologies, maintaining its competitive edge in the region.
